The Aermacchi SF.260 is a light aircraft marketed as an aerobatics and military trainer. It was designed by Stelio Frati in 1964, originally for Aviamilano, though actual production was undertaken when SIAI Marchetti purchased the design. The military versions are popular with smaller air forces, which can also arm it for use in the close-support role. Known for its pure lines and excellent flying characteristics, it is available in both piston-engine and turboprop variants. The SF-260 has been used by various civilian aerobatic teams and some 27 different military customers have already bought more than 900 SF-260 in all variants.
This sport scale Marchetti SF-260 comes pre-built with a bench to flying field time! Featuring a built-up balsa and light plywood airframe, coming pre-covered in a semi-scale color scheme. Tricycle landing gear ready for retracts, a slight bit of dihedral in the long wing, and a large tail contribute to smooth, graceful, scale-like aerobatics. Flaps slow the model down for effortless landings, making this a fun, everyday flier.
To complete this model you will need 10 standard size servos, a .91 cu. in. 2-stroke glow engine, and a 5-6 channel transmitter and receiver.

Specs:
Wingspan: 1750mm
Length: 1450mm
Flying Weight: 4200g
Wing Area: 45 dm²
